First lets talk about gear ….. camera’s. Here are my do’s:: Do bring the new DLSR you bought especially for the wedding with the 2 lens and the big flash and the oversized sling backpack. Don’t bring it to the actual ceremony!!!! What then why did I buy the fancy new Nikon!!! Trust me you are going to a wedding on the Emerald coast of Florida there will be 100’s of photo’s to take before the ceremony and after. But remember that “during” the ceremony you have been invited as a guest NOT TO WORK so act like a guest. If you would like to bring a small point and shoot to quickly and discreetly take a photo of the groom and bride and maybe the kiss that is great. Or better yet turn the volume off on your phone and use the camera on it.
During the ceremony pay close attention to the professional photographer. where is he/she standing – or they standing squatting lying on the sand? Are they moving fast to capture a quick smile or slowing “grabbing” every emotion. The reason to watch the photographer is because the photographers of the Sunshine state in Destin, Panama City, Navarre are use to the beach. they work countless hours on the beaches of Destin shooting beach weddings working with event planners and they know the right angel and the correct shot to capture.
after the ceremony go ahead and grab your big fancy new Nikon {we all know you didn’t leave it in the room} and take photo’s tons of them work the crowd get candid shots of the moms and the uncles and the kids running all over the beach. Take a few photo’s of some local beach goers. But do not go within 100 feet of the professional. It is fine to “watch” from a distance” to again gather tips of the trade. But whatever you do do not shadow or shoot the same poses. If and this is a big if!!! there is time after the photo shoot ask politely if few shots can be made for your studio. If not that’s fine go to the reception and blast away once again grabbing those candid moments.
To summarize – - Do bring your big Fancy Nikon {just not to the beach wedding ceremony} Do Not get in the way of the professional – and remember you are there as a guest let the hired help have a chance to do their jobs………and do not forget to have someone take a photo of you with a sunset on the beautiful beaches of the emerald coast.

Expedited passports are a possibility. With this expedited service, you will pay an additional fee in exchange for having your application rushed through. Please note, expedited service does not guarantee your application will be accepted. If your application is denied, you will not receive a refund on the fee you charged.
The fee charged will range from a low price to extreme high prices. Aren’t all expedited services the same?
Unfortunately, not all service providers are the same. But this is a good thing too! You will find that providers of this service vary as much as the passport holders needing their services. The price you see for the services may or may not include the application process as well. So if you see “Expedited Passports $19.99!” you will probably want to see how much they are charging for the application process as well.
On the same token, if you see “Expedited Passports $99.99!” you will want to insure this includes both the application fee as well as the expedited fee. As you can see, the fees will vary according to what is included in the package. This also means you will want to investigate any other “hidden” fees you may find once you start the process.
Upfront pricing is going to be the way to go. If you get quoted a price, please, make sure that price is for the full package deal you need. Generally, if the price seems too good to be true, it is. Yes, that old adage still holds truth today and no truer words have been spoken.

Here are some things that you can ask your auto insurance company for:
- Ask if you can receive a discount if you have more than one type of insurance with their company. For instance, you may find that you can have your auto insurance and your homeowner’s insurance with this company and they will provide you with a combined discount. Carry all of your insurance policies with them, such as auto, home, and life and you may find that you can get even more money off.
- If the driver of the car is a student or is listed as a driver on the car, you may find that you can get a good student discount. This is where the student maintains at least a B average on their report card. You may be required to take that report card to the automobile insurance company each time it comes out, but it really pays off. If grades go down, the discount may disappear until the grades go back up.
- See if there are any safe driver discounts available. When you haven’t had a ticket or an accident, you may find that there are discounts available for you.
- If you are a senior citizen and you’ve not had any accidents in a specific amount of time, there may be discounts available to you.
- You can always raise your deductible to cheaper car insurance premium online from auto insurer. However, you need to keep in mind that doing so will result in a higher out-of-pocket expense if an accident does occur. The standard deductible is $500, but some individuals will go as high as $2,000 to save some money on their premium. If you can pay $2,000 if an accident occurs, then that will work fine. Just make sure your deductible is not higher than what you can afford in case damage is done to your car and you need to pay it.
- You may wish to shop around. You may find a company that offers the same coverage for a lower price. You always want to compare before you make a commitment.
